1. A method for driving a backlight unit (BLU), the method comprising:
controlling a first switch and a second switch to alternately open and close based on a vertical synchronization signal of a current frame;
closing the first switch at a first time point in the current frame;
based on the first switch being closed and the second switch being open:
generating, by a first pixel integrated circuit (PIC), a first pulse modulation signal based on a first packet output from a pixel driver integrated circuit (PDIC) and applying the first pulse modulation signal to a first backlight unit (BLU) line connected to the first PIC and corresponding to a first light emitting diode; and
generating, by a second PIC, a second pulse modulation signal based on a second packet output from the PDIC and applying the second pulse modulation signal to a second BLU line connected to the second PIC and corresponding to a second light emitting diode;
closing the second switch at a second time point in the current frame; and
based on the second switch being closed and the first switch being open:
generating, by the first PIC, a third pulse modulation signal based on the first packet output from the PDIC and applying the third pulse modulation signal to a third BLU line connected to the first PIC and corresponding to a third light emitting diode; and
generating, by the second PIC, a fourth pulse modulation signal based on the second packet output from the PDIC and applying the fourth pulse modulation signal to a fourth BLU line connected to the second PIC and corresponding to a fourth light emitting diode.
